summaryrefslogtreecommitdiffstats
path: root/src/gallium/drivers/radeonsi
Commit message (Expand)AuthorAgeFilesLines
* radeonsi: Dump TGSI code prior to doing TGSI->LLVM conversion.Tom Stellard2012-07-121-1/+6
* gallium: Add PIPE_CAP_START_INSTANCEFredrik Höglund2012-06-191-0/+1
* radeonsi: Don't always re-compile shaders after they're bound.Michel Dänzer2012-06-121-6/+1
* radeonsi: Use linear instead of constant interpolation for now.Michel Dänzer2012-06-122-4/+22
* radeonsi: Only dump shaders with environment variable RADEON_DUMP_SHADERS=1.Michel Dänzer2012-06-121-8/+15
* automake: Globally add stub automake targets to the old Makefiles.Eric Anholt2012-06-111-3/+0
* radeonsi: Remove use.sgpr* intrinsics, use load instructions insteadTom Stellard2012-05-291-44/+36
* radeonsi: Handle TGSI CONST registersTom Stellard2012-05-291-42/+83
* radeonsi: Only honour point related rasterizer state when rendering points.Michel Dänzer2012-05-181-2/+3
* radeonsi: Fix parameter cache offsets for fragment shader inputs.Michel Dänzer2012-05-183-2/+4
* gallium/radeon: Fix r300g tiling breakage.Michel Dänzer2012-05-161-0/+1
* radeonsi: Initial tiling support.Michel Dänzer2012-05-165-128/+356
* radeonsi: Bump MAX_DRAW_CS_DWORDS.Michel Dänzer2012-05-163-3/+3
* radeonsi: Keep around copies of original sampler states.Michel Dänzer2012-05-141-0/+2
* radeonsi: Flesh out shader interpolation related code.Michel Dänzer2012-05-141-4/+17
* radeonsi: Add proper SI family names.Michel Dänzer2012-05-141-1/+3
* radeonsi: Separate states for samplers and sampler views.Michel Dänzer2012-05-142-3/+6
* radeonsi: Fixups for drawing with an index buffer.Michel Dänzer2012-05-143-14/+13
* radeonsi: remove slab allocator for pipe_resource (used mainly for user buffers)Marek Olšák2012-05-133-41/+3
* gallium: remove user_buffer_create from the interfaceMarek Olšák2012-05-123-29/+0
* radeonsi: Fixed point vertex formats aren't supported.Michel Dänzer2012-05-121-4/+5
* Merge branch 'gallium-userbuf'Marek Olšák2012-05-117-43/+38
|\
| * gallium: remove pipe_resource::user_ptrMarek Olšák2012-04-301-5/+0
| * radeonsi: don't create temporary user buffer for r600_upload_const_bufferMarek Olšák2012-04-303-32/+25
| * gallium: add void *user_buffer to pipe_constant_bufferMarek Olšák2012-04-301-0/+6
| * gallium: add void *user_buffer in pipe_index_bufferMarek Olšák2012-04-303-6/+3
| * gallium: remove pipe_context::redefine_user_bufferMarek Olšák2012-04-301-1/+0
| * gallium: change set_constant_buffer to be UBO-friendlyMarek Olšák2012-04-302-5/+5
| * gallium: add PIPE_CAP_CONSTANT_BUFFER_OFFSET_ALIGNMENTMarek Olšák2012-04-301-0/+3
| * gallium: add PIPE_CAP_USER_INDEX_BUFFERS and PIPE_CAP_USER_CONSTANT_BUFFERSMarek Olšák2012-04-301-0/+2
* | gallium/tgsi: Move interpolation info from tgsi_declaration to a separate token.Francisco Jerez2012-05-111-4/+4
* | radeonsi: Properly translate vertex format swizzle.Michel Dänzer2012-05-113-23/+23
* | radeonsi: Set NONE format for unused vertex shader position export slots.Michel Dänzer2012-05-101-3/+3
* | radeonsi: Eliminate one more magic number for texture image resources.Michel Dänzer2012-05-101-3/+3
* | radeonsi: Fix vertex buffer resource for stride 0.Michel Dänzer2012-05-101-1/+5
|/
* radeonsi: make r600_buffer_transfer_unmap a no-opMarek Olšák2012-04-291-7/+1
* radeonsi: use u_default_transfer_inline_writeMarek Olšák2012-04-293-26/+3
* winsys/radeon: simplify buffer map/unmap functionsMarek Olšák2012-04-297-35/+35
* radeonsi: stop using u_vbuf and adapt to gallium interface changesMarek Olšák2012-04-2411-98/+100
* gallium: add user_ptr in pipe_resourceMarek Olšák2012-04-241-0/+1
* radeon: Move radeon_llvm_emit.cpp declarations into their own headerTom Stellard2012-04-231-0/+1
* radeonsi: Replace magic numbers for vertex buffer resource.Michel Dänzer2012-04-191-4/+8
* radeonsi: (User) SGPR related cleanups.Michel Dänzer2012-04-193-16/+33
* radeonsi: Fix sampler offsets for shader intrinsic.Michel Dänzer2012-04-191-2/+2
* radeonsi: Replace more magic numbers for sampler state.Michel Dänzer2012-04-191-7/+7
* radeonsi: Fix mip filter encoding in sampler state.Michel Dänzer2012-04-191-3/+3
* radeonsi: Set tiling mode index for depth/stencil buffers.Michel Dänzer2012-04-191-19/+37
* radeonsi: Improve calculation of number of pixel shader interpolants.Michel Dänzer2012-04-181-23/+7
* radeonsi: Fix calculation of pitch value in sampler view state.Michel Dänzer2012-04-181-4/+2
* radeonsi: Set tiling mode index in sampler view state.Michel Dänzer2012-04-181-0/+1